Mwaka Luguru
Zambia
2022
After studying agricultural science throughout secondary school, Mwaka Luguru fell in love with the subject. Mwaka’s passion for agriculture pushed her to ensure that rural agricultural development, food security, gender, and climate change were the focus of her studies. Now working as a Senior Community Development Officer, she aims to provide alternative livelihoods for vulnerable groups, especially women, through diversified income sources. She is excited to gain more knowledge and skills on gender-responsive policies, social inclusion, equity, equality, and policy formulation and its effective implementation through the GRASP Fellowship.  
“Having knowledge around gender-responsive policies, social inclusion, equity, equality, and policy formulation is important for empowering more young people and community members in understanding and appreciating the importance of gender issues.”
Area of Focus
Promotion and enhanced capacity building of local communities in support of alternative livelihood options
